Background

IL-17B is a member of the IL-17 family of structurally related proteins (1). Unlike other IL-17 family members, IL-17B is a non-covalently linked homodimer (1,2). IL-17B is expressed by chondrocytes and neurons, and binds to the IL-17RB receptor (1-4). Human IL-17B has been shown to induce TNF-α and IL-1β from monocytic THP-1 cells and may be involved in neutrophil recruitment in vivo (3). However, the exact biological functions of IL-17B remain elusive.

Endotoxin

Less than 0.01 ng endotoxin/1 μg mIL-17B.

Purity

>98% as determined by SDS-PAGE of 6 μg reduced (+) and non-reduced (-) recombinant mIL-17B. All lots are greater than 98% pure.

Source / Purification

Recombinant mouse IL-17B (mIL-17B) His21-Phe180 (Accession #NP_062381) was produced in E. coli at Cell Signaling Technology.

Bioactivity

The activity of mIL-17B was assessed by its ability to bind to IL-17RB in a functional ELISA. The concentration at which half-maximal binding was observed for each lot was 0.1-1.0 µg/ml.
